from dataclasses import dataclass
from functools import cached_property
import json
from pathlib import Path
from typing import Iterator, Sequence
from my.core import get_files, Res, datetime_aware
from my.core.compat import fromisoformat
from my.experimental.destructive_parsing import Manager
from my.config import topcoder as config # type: ignore[attr-defined]
def inputs() -> Sequence[Path]:
return get_files(config.export_path)
@dataclass
class Competition:
contest_id: str
contest: str
percentile: float
date_str: str
@cached_property
def uid(self) -> str:
return self.contest_id
@cached_property
def when(self) -> datetime_aware:
return fromisoformat(self.date_str)
@classmethod
def make(cls, j) -> Iterator[Res['Competition']]:
assert isinstance(j.pop('rating'), float)
assert isinstance(j.pop('placement'), int)
cid = j.pop('challengeId')
cname = j.pop('challengeName')
percentile = j.pop('percentile')
date_str = j.pop('date')
yield cls(
contest_id=cid,
contest=cname,
percentile=percentile,
date_str=date_str,
)
def _parse_one(p: Path) -> Iterator[Res[Competition]]:
d = json.loads(p.read_text())
# TODO manager should be a context manager?
m = Manager()
h = m.helper(d)
h.pop_if_primitive('version', 'id')
h = h.zoom('result')
h.check('success', True)
h.check('status', 200)
h.pop_if_primitive('metadata')
h = h.zoom('content')
h.pop_if_primitive('handle', 'handleLower', 'userId', 'createdAt', 'updatedAt', 'createdBy', 'updatedBy')
# NOTE at the moment it's empty for me, but it will result in an error later if there is some data here
h.zoom('DEVELOP').zoom('subTracks')
h = h.zoom('DATA_SCIENCE')
# TODO multi zoom? not sure which axis, e.g.
# zoom('SRM', 'history') or zoom('SRM', 'MARATHON_MATCH')
# or zoom(('SRM', 'history'), ('MARATHON_MATCH', 'history'))
srms = h.zoom('SRM').zoom('history')
mms = h.zoom('MARATHON_MATCH').zoom('history')
for c in srms.item + mms.item:
# NOTE: so here we are actually just using pure dicts in .make method
# this is kinda ok since it will be checked by parent Helper
# but also expects cooperation from .make method (e.g. popping items from the dict)
# could also wrap in helper and pass to .make .. not sure
# an argument could be made that .make isn't really a class methond..
# it's pretty specific to this parser onl
yield from Competition.make(j=c)
yield from m.check()
def data() -> Iterator[Res[Competition]]:
*_, last = inputs()
return _parse_one(last)
